Latitude9Lisa Oct 28th, 2011 08:21 AM

Fiesta del Mariscos is south of the Tarcoles. (If you recall the former Steve and Lisa's on the beach, it is just south of that). Mariscos is on the beach, more typical Costa Rican cuisine, fantastic pescado dishes, great seafood soup, probably the best pescado entero I've had in some time. Yes, they have wine too! (chilean or something, you wouldn't find it in Wine Spectator but it drinkable) It's difficult to beat Villas Caletas but for typica CR, I really like Fiesta del Mariscos! Lisa
